The Romans developed a sewer system to deliver waste and waste matter far from their old resources city now referred to as Rome, Italy. This complex sewer system started as an open air canal developed by the Etruscans. The Romans gradually built over the open air canal and transformed the Cloaca Maxima right into a protected drain system.

Some components of the Cloaca Maxima are still being used to this extremely day. Since you individuals have actually been presented to some ancient pipes history allowed's fast-forward to 1596, concerning 500 years back, when Sir John Harington, godson of Queen Elizabeth I, created the initial flushing bathroom. Along with being excellent swimmers, rats can hold their breath for 3 mins, and they can walk water for as much as 3 hours. Did Thomas Crapper develop the commode? As high as we might want Thomas Crapper to have invented the commode, he did not. He did have a substantial influence on production, style, and the promo of shower room items during the late 1800's with the early 1900s.

Crapper was the owner of Thomas Crapper & Co and possessed the very first toilet, bathroom, and sink display room. He passed away in 1910, however his showroom lasted till 1966. In 1596, Sir John Harrington produced the flushing toilet. It took 7.5 gallons of water to "purge" and might be shared by up to 20 individuals during times of water shortage.
He designed the S-shaped pipe beneath the dish, which uses water to secure the sewage gas from going into an area with the toilet - emergency plumber.
